How much do independent contractor forestry j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 25, 2026, the average yearly pay for independent contractor forestry in Oregon is $43,924.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$36,500.00 and $49,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an independent contractor forestry?

An Independent Contractor Forestry job involves providing forestry-related services on a contract basis rather than as a full-time employee. Contractors may perform tasks such as tree planting, timber harvesting, land management, fire prevention, or ecological restoration. They typically work with government agencies, private landowners, or forestry companies. Since they are independent, they manage their own schedules, tools, and business expenses. This role requires knowledge of forestry practices, physical stamina, and often specialized equipment.

What types of projects or clients does an independent contractor forestry typically work with?

Independent Contractor Forestry professionals often work on diverse projects such as timber assessments, reforestation planning, habitat restoration, and environmental compliance audits. Clients can include private landowners, government agencies, timber companies, conservation organizations, and consulting firms. The variety of projects offers opportunities to gain experience in multiple facets of forestry and natural resource management. This independent role allows for flexibility in choosing projects, but also requires a proactive approach to networking and building client relationships for ongoing work.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an independent contractor forestry?

To thrive as an Independent Contractor in Forestry, you need expertise in forest management practices, ecological assessment, and a degree in forestry or related field, often supplemented with field experience. Familiarity with GIS mapping software, forest inventory tools, and certifications such as SAF (Society of American Foresters) accreditation are typically important. Strong problem-solving abilities, self-direction, and effective communication skills help set top contractors apart. These competencies are crucial for ensuring effective stewardship of forest resources, regulatory compliance, and successful collaboration with clients, agencies, and other professionals.

The Community
  • Roseburg, Oregon, located in the scenic Umpqua River Valley, is a charming city that blends natural beauty with a welcoming community.
  • It is known as the "Timber Capital of the Nation," its history and economy are deeply tied to forestry.
  • Nearby landmarks like the breathtaking Umpqua National Forest and Crater Lake National Park offer endless outdoor adventures, from hiking and fishing to camping and wildlife watching.
  • Wine enthusiasts can explore the Umpqua Valley's renowned wineries, while history buffs enjoy the Douglas County Museum.
  • Roseburg experiences mild winters and warm, dry summers, making it ideal for outdoor activities year-round.
  • The city's location makes it a convenient hub for accessing both the Oregon coast and the Cascade Mountains.
